The document discusses database management systems, focusing on lock-based protocols and timestamp-based concurrency control mechanisms. It explains the two-phase locking protocol, including its phases and limitations, as well as timestamp-based protocols that ensure serializability and manage conflicting operations. Additionally, it covers various relational algebra operations such as union, set difference, and join operations.
The document discusses database management systems, focusing on lock-based protocols and timestamp-based concurrency control mechanisms. It explains the two-phase locking protocol, including its phases and limitations, as well as timestamp-based protocols that ensure serializability and manage conflicting operations. Additionally, it covers various relational algebra operations such as union, set difference, and join operations.